According to 6Wresearch internal database and industry insights, the Global Aircraft Nacelle Market was valued at USD 4.5 Billion in 2024 and is expected to reach USD 8.6 Billion by 2031, growing at a compound annual growth rate of 9.20% during the forecast period (2025-2031).
The global aircraft nacelle market is experiencing steady growth driven by the increasing demand for new commercial aircraft worldwide. Nacelles are crucial components of aircraft engines, providing aerodynamic efficiency and noise reduction. Factors such as the rise in air passenger traffic, fleet expansion plans by airlines, and the need for fuel-efficient aircraft are fueling the market growth. Additionally, technological advancements in nacelle design to enhance performance and reduce maintenance costs are further driving market expansion. The market is characterized by key players such as Safran, UTC Aerospace Systems, and Leonardo S.p.A., who are continuously investing in research and development to stay competitive. With the increasing focus on sustainability and environmental regulations, the demand for lightweight and fuel-efficient nacelles is expected to drive market growth in the coming years.

Government policies related to the Global Aircraft Nacelle Market primarily focus on safety regulations, environmental standards, and trade agreements. Regulatory bodies such as the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) and the European Aviation Safety Agency (EASA) set stringent safety requirements for aircraft components, including nacelles, to ensure the overall airworthiness of aircraft. In terms of environmental standards, governments worldwide are increasingly emphasizing the reduction of carbon emissions and noise pollution from aircraft operations, which impacts nacelle design and materials. Trade agreements and tariffs also play a significant role in shaping the competitive landscape of the market, influencing the manufacturing locations and supply chains of nacelle producers. Compliance with these government policies is crucial for aircraft nacelle manufacturers to operate globally and meet the evolving demands of the aviation industry.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
